House raising services involve elevating a property to a higher level, typically to protect against flooding, water damage, or other environmental concerns. The process generally includes lifting the entire structure off its foundation, reinforcing or replacing the foundation as needed, and then lowering the house onto a new or modified foundation. This approach allows for the property to be preserved while addressing issues related to ground level changes or floodplain regulations. Skilled service providers use specialized equipment and techniques to ensure the house is lifted safely and accurately, minimizing potential damage during the process.

The overview below groups typical House Raising proj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Schaumburg,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ic House Raising Costs - The typical cost range for raising a house varies widely, often between $30,000 and $100,000 depending on the size and foundation type. For example, a small home might cost around $35,000, while larger properties could reach $90,000 or more.
Foundation and Soil Conditions - Costs are influenced by soil stability and foundation type, with challenging conditions potentially increasing expenses by several thousand dollars. On average, foundation work can add $10,000 to $30,000 to the total project budget.
Additional Services and Permits - Expenses for permits, inspections, and auxiliary services typically range from $2,000 to $8,000. These costs vary based on local regulations and the scope of work required for the house raising process.
Location and Accessibility - House raising costs in Schaumburg, IL, and nearby areas may differ based on accessibility and local labor rates, with typical projects falling within the $40,000 to $120,000 range. Difficult terrain or limited access can lead to higher costs for local pros.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
